Technical Overview
Built on DECT wireless technology, the Spectralink 7622 ensures secure, interference-free communication within its operational range. The cordless design eliminates cable clutter and provides freedom of movement, while the integrated speakerphone and volume control enhance usability during calls.
The handset includes 12 ring tones for customizable alerts and features an alarm function for reminders or notifications. Its compact form factor measures 5.80" x 2" x 0.90" and weighs approximately 4.10 oz, making it lightweight and easy to carry. The color LCD screen with a resolution of 128 x 160 pixels offers clear text and icon visibility, even in varied lighting conditions.

Specifications
| Specifications | |
|---|---|
| Manufacturer | Cisco Systems, Inc |
| Manufacturer Part Number | SP-SLNK-7622-NA= |
| Brand Name | Spectralink |
| Product Model | 7622 |
| Product Name | 7622 1G9 Handset |
| Product Type | Handset |
| Technical Information | |
| Connectivity Technology | Cordless |
| Wireless Technology | DECT |
| Number of Ring Tones | 12 |
| Features | Rechargeable Battery,Alarm,Speakerphone,Volume Control |
| Phone Book/Directory Memory | 350 |
| Display & Graphics | |
| Screen Type | Color LCD |
| Screen Resolution | 128 x 160 |
| Interfaces/Ports | |
| Headset Port | Yes |
| Battery Information | |
| Battery Talk Time | 1 Day |
| Battery Standby Time | 118 Hour |
| Physical Characteristics | |
| Height | 5.80" (147.32 mm) |
| Width | 2" (50.80 mm) |
| Depth | 0.90" (22.86 mm) |
| Weight (Approximate) | 4.10 oz (116.23 g) |
| Miscellaneous | |
| Package Contents | 7622 1G9 Handset Battery Desk Charger Universal Power Supply |

What wireless technology does the Spectralink 7622 handset use?
The Spectralink 7622 uses DECT (Digital Enhanced Cordless Telecommunications) wireless technology. DECT provides secure, high-quality voice transmission with minimal interference, making it suitable for enterprise environments where reliable cordless communication is essential. It operates on dedicated frequency bands to avoid congestion from Wi-Fi or other devices.
How long does the battery last on a single charge?
The rechargeable battery delivers up to 1 day of talk time and 118 hours of standby time. This extended battery life supports all-day use without frequent recharging, ideal for shifts in healthcare, retail, or warehouse settings where constant availability is required. The included desk charger allows for convenient overnight charging.
